Excalibur エンベデッド・プロセッサ・ソリューションについて
|
アルテラは、ロジック、メモリ、およびプロセッサ・コアを結合して、システム全体を 1つのデバイス上に実装可能にする業界初のエンベデッド・プロセッサ FPGA ソリューションを実現しました。 アルテラのプロセッサ・ポートフォリオには、統合化プロセッサ・サブシステムとコンフィギュレーション可能なアルテラ FPGA 用 Nios®エンベデッド・プロセッサを提供する Excalibur デバイスがあります。 アルテラのエンベデッド・プロセッサ・ソリューションは、工業用および自動車用からアクセスおよび伝送アプリケーションまで、広範囲の用途に使用できます。 これらのプロセッサ・ソリューションは、アルテラの FPGA アーキテクチャとも互換性があり、Quartus® II デザイン・ソフトウェア、SOPC Builder システム開発ツール、GNUPro Toolkit 開発ツールなどのシームレスなデザイン・ツール・パッケージによって完全にサポートされており、すべてが両方のプロセッサ・ファミリに対して最適化されています。 Excalibur デバイスと Nios エンベデッド・プロセッサはどちらも業界標準のソフトウェア開発ツール、デバッグ・ソリューション、およびオペレーティング・システム・サポートでもサポートされており、system-on-a-programmable-chip (SOPC) デザインのための完璧な開発パッケージを提供します。 Excalibur デバイスExcalibur デバイスは、業界標準の ARM922T プロセッサをデバッグ・モジュール、オンチップ・メモリ、および APEX 20KE デバイス類似アーキテクチャを持つペリフェラルと統合します。 この組み合わせによって、最高 200 MHz (210 Dhrystone MIPS) のシステム性能を備え、エンベデッド RAM、フェーズ・ロック・ループ(PLL)、および最新の I/O 機能を搭載した FPGA を提供します。 Nios エンベデッド・プロセッサNios エンベデッド・プロセッサは、SOPC デザイン用 のメモリ、プロセッサ、ペリフェラル、および他の IP (Intellectual Property) を統合する柔軟性を提供します。 このコンフィギュレーション可能な汎用 RISC プロセッサは、容易にユーザ・ロジックと統合して、アルテラの FPGA にプログラムすることができます。 プロセッサは、16 ビット・インストラクション・セット、ユーザ選択可能な 16 ビットまたは 32 ビット・データ・パス、さまざまな用途に合わせてコンフィギュレーション可能な標準ソフト・ペリフェラルのライブラリを備えています。 SOPC BuilderSOPC Builder は、高性能 SOPC デザインの作成と検証作業を劇的に簡略化する自動システム開発ツールです。 このツールは、SOPC 開発のシステム定義、統合化、および検証フェーズを自動化することによって、「Time-to-Market」の期間を短縮します。 設計者は SOPC Builder を使用して、1 つのツールにより従来の system-on-a-chip (SOC) デザインの何分の 1 かの時間で、ハードウェアからソフトウェアまで、完全なシステムを定義することができます。 SOPC Builder は Quartus II ソフトウェア内で統合されているので、FPGA 設計者はすぐに革新的な新型開発ツールを使うことができます。 エンベデッド・ソフトウェアアルテラの完璧なソリューションは FPGA に限定されません。 プロセッサの成功には、エンベデッド・ソフトウェアが不可欠です。 さらにサードベンダからの業界標準の開発ツール、デバッグ・ソリューション、およびオペレーティング・システムもアルテラのエンベデッド・プロセッサ FPGA ソリューションをサポートします。 開発ボードおよび開発キットアルテラは、ツール群を充実させるために、何種類かのExcalibur デバイスや Nios エンベデッド・プロセッサ用開発ボードおよび開発キットを提供しています。 また、主要サードパーティ・ベンダと連携して、エンベデッド・プロセッサ・ソリューション向けの開発プラットフォームやアドオン・ボードも製造しています。
|
|
![]() ![]() |



